Summary

You will serve as an Equipment Specialist in the WHE Compliance Division, Transportation Product Line, Public Works Department NAVSTA Norfolk, of Naval Facilities Engineering Systems Command (NAVFAC) Mid-Atlantic. The organizational title of this position is Senior Equipment Specialist (Cranes).

Duties

You will serve as a subject matter expert (SME)/consultant for all types of Weight Handling Equipment (WHE).You will provide expert technical guidance in the development of plans for the overhaul, repair, and modernization of WHE.You will serve as the SME in the configuration control management for an assigned class of cranes to ensure compliance with relevant standards, including NAVCRANECENINST 11450.2, NAVFAC P-307, and NAVSEA Crane Quality Manual.You will serve as a senior Project Manager for large-scale, multi-disciplinary projects related to Navy cranes.

Qualifications

Your resume must demonstrate at least one year of specialized experience at or equivalent to the GS-12 grade level or pay band in the Federal service or equivalent experience in the private or public sector performing the following duties: 1) Applying a wide range of technical disciplines (mechanical, structural, electrical) as a subject matter expert/consultant for all types of Weight Handling Equipment (WHE), including portal, mobile, tower, container, gantry, floating, and overhead traveling bridge cranes; 2) Applying knowledge of NAVFAC P-307 and other applicable instructions/policies to perform maintenance, testing, inspection of cranes and rigging gear; and 3) Managing projects and accomplishing objectives within resource constraints. Incumbent must be physically capable and willing to climb to heights of up to, and sometimes exceeding, 100 feet on cranes or crane booms to conduct inspections, which may occur as frequently as once a week or more. This position demands above-average agility and dexterity in the use of arms and legs to perform crane inspections. Incumbent must possess good vision and hearing and must successfully pas a pre-assignment physical exam to ensure fitness for the role's physical requirements.
